springboot词云图
时间: 2024-04-04 20:28:30 浏览: 26
Spring Boot是一个用于创建独立的、基于Spring的应用程序的框架。它简化了Spring应用程序的开发过程,提供了一种快速构建应用程序的方式。词云图是一种可视化工具,用于展示文本数据中词语的频率和重要性。在Spring Boot中生成词云图可以通过以下步骤实现:
1. 收集文本数据:首先需要收集要生成词云图的文本数据。可以从数据库、文件或者网络等来源获取数据。
2. 数据预处理:对收集到的文本数据进行预处理,包括去除停用词、标点符号和数字等,以及进行分词操作。
3. 统计词频:统计每个词语在文本数据中出现的频率,可以使用Python中的nltk库或者其他文本处理工具来实现。
4. 生成词云图:使用Python中的wordcloud库或者其他可视化工具,将统计得到的词频数据生成词云图。
5. 自定义样式:可以根据需求自定义词云图的样式,包括字体、颜色、形状等。
6. 展示词云图:将生成的词云图展示在网页或者其他应用程序中,可以使用HTML、JavaScript等技术来实现。
相关问题
springboot甘特图
Springboot甘特图是一个基于Springboot框架的项目进度管理系统,该系统使用了MybatisPlus作为ORM框架,同时集成了Bootstrap作为前端展示的框架。该系统采用了最新版本的Springboot2.x,旨在提供稳定、高效的企业级应用。它结合了Spring生态圈中微服务的特性,并利用MybatisPlus对Mybatis进行增强,保持了原有的开发方式。通过集成Bootstrap,系统具有了绚丽的前端界面,形成了一套完整的商业系统。使用Springboot甘特图可以帮助开发人员实践项目,并获取工作经验。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
springboot vue图书馆
SpringBoot和Vue是目前比较流行的前后端框架,它们可以搭配使用来开发Web应用程序。关于SpringBoot和Vue的图书馆,我找到了一些开源项目,您可以参考一下:
1. 《基于SpringBoot+Vue的高校图书馆管理系统》:这是一个基于SpringBoot+Vue框架开发的高校图书馆管理系统,具有一个高校图书馆管理系统该有的所有功能。
2. 《springboot+vue图书管理系统》:这是一个前后端分离的项目,代码简洁规范,注释说明详细,易于理解和学习。
3. 《基于SpringBoot+Vue的图书管理系统》:这个项目使用了SpringBoot、Vue、Element-Plus等技术栈,实现了基本的登陆注册、增删改查等功能。